The Roar Heard Round the World: Major Tournaments

The true power of the global Moroccan fan base emerges during major international tournaments like the Africa Cup of Nations and the FIFA World Cup. These events become epicenters of Moroccan pride and solidarity, showcasing the diaspora’s ability to mobilize and create an unforgettable atmosphere.

Qatar 2022: A Defining Moment

The 2022 FIFA World Cup in Qatar was perhaps the most significant demonstration of the diaspora’s influence. Moroccans from across the globe converged in unprecedented numbers, creating a “home away from home” atmosphere for the Atlas Lions. Their constant, passionate support—characterized by Chants, Drums, and Tifos: The Unique Traditions of Morocco Football Supporters—was widely credited as a crucial factor in the team’s historic semi-final run.

The Psychological Impact on the Atlas Lions

The support from diaspora fans is not lost on the players. The Atlas Lions frequently acknowledge the immense boost they receive from seeing stadiums filled with their countrymen, regardless of where the match is played. This global backing has a tangible How Morocco Football Fans Inspire: The Psychological Impact on Players.

Fueling Player Performance

Players often speak of feeling an extra surge of energy and motivation when they see the sea of red and green in the stands. Knowing that millions of Moroccans worldwide are passionately supporting them, often sacrificing greatly to be there, instills a deep sense of responsibility and pride. This psychological boost can prove critical in high-pressure games, pushing players to perform beyond expectations.

A Sense of Global Belonging

For many players with diaspora roots, the support from fans living abroad resonates deeply. It reinforces that they represent not just a country but a global family. This sense of belonging and collective effort strengthens team cohesion and fosters a powerful bond between the squad and its worldwide supporters.
